Transaction a5f839bdd56d0d84c4afcc9589595b43c046147eed0705c40b42d1d587810576
1 Input
1 Output
-
a5f839bdd56d0d84c4afcc9589595b43c046147eed0705c40b42d1d587810576:0
- value
- 589956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31c0a927ab0fdf24dca5eb529657a087b5b7863c OP_EQUAL
- address
- 36E5qFKxzyvTHrLhFX31PJB5Nyo52vBU7b